This is an exciting opportunity to join the curatorial team at the Institute of Contemporary Arts (ICA) and contribute to our inspiring exhibition programme under the new Director Bengi Ünsal. We are looking for an experienced Curator with a demonstrable knowledge of contemporary art, current practices and interest in advancing under-represented perspectives to take forward the exhibition programme.

You will have proven curatorial experience with a track record of devising and delivering solo, thematic and commissioned projects with imagination and distinction. The post holder will work closely with diverse audiences, supporters and other stakeholders as well as other members of the Curatorial team, who on occasion, will also use the gallery spaces to programme small-scale interventions ranging from a music gig, performance or learning programme.
